Parent and Tot
The Parent & Tot levels introduce young children to the aquatic environment in a fun, safe setting adapted to their stage of development, while allowing them to share a special experience with a parent or caregiver.
Through structured in-water activities, the program focuses on play, exploration and positive interactions to gradually build comfort and confidence in the water. Activities also help accompanying adults develop good aquatic safety practices and discover the Lifesaving Society’s Aqua Bon tips.
Activities are led by certified instructors who guide families through the learning process and answer their questions.
Levels Adapted to Each Child’s Development
The appropriate level is based on the child’s age and stage of development.
A first introduction to the water that allows babies to become familiar with the aquatic environment while accompanied by a parent or caregiver.
Designed for children from 4 to 12 months to have fun and become comfortable in the water with their parent or caregiver.
Duration
8 to 10 lessons of 30 minutes
Number of Children per Instructor
1 to 12 children (each accompanied by a parent)
Playful activities allow children to continue exploring the water and gradually become more comfortable, always accompanied by an adult.
Designed for children from 12 to 24 months to have fun in the water with their parent or caregiver.
Duration
8 to 10 lessons of 30 minutes
Number of Children per Instructor
1 to 12 children (each accompanied by a parent)
Activities adapted to young children help build greater confidence in the water and gradually develop their first aquatic skills, with the participation of an accompanying adult.
Designed for children from 2 to 3 years to have fun in the water with their parent or caregiver.
Duration
8 to 10 lessons of 30 minutes
Number of Children per Instructor
1 to 12 children (each accompanied by a parent)
